Delightful Egg and Rice Skillet Dinner
Ingredients
- 1 cup uncooked rice
- 2 cups water
- 4 large eggs
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/4 teaspoon paprika
- 1 tablespoon fresh parsley, chopped (optional for garnish)
Instructions
1. Cook the Rice:
- In a medium saucepan over medium-high heat, combine 1 cup of uncooked rice and 2 cups of water.
- Bring to a boil, then reduce the heat to low and cover.
- Simmer for approximately 18 minutes or until the rice has absorbed all the water.
- Remove from heat and let it sit, covered, for 5 minutes. Fluff with a fork before proceeding.
2. Prepare the Eggs:
- In a large non-stick skillet, he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il over medium heat.
- Once the oil is shimmering, crack the 4 large eggs into the skillet.
- Sprinkle with 1/2 teaspoon salt, 1/4 teaspoon pepper, 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der, and 1/4 teaspoon paprika.
- Cook the eggs until the whites are set but the yolks are still runny, about 3-4 minutes. For firmer yolks, cover the skillet and cook an additional 2 minutes.
3. Combine and Serve:
- Add the cooked rice to the skillet with the eggs.
- Gently fold the rice into the eggs, trying not to break the yolks.
- Cook for an additional 2 minutes to warm through.
- Garnish with 1 tablespoon of fresh chopped parsley if desired.
4. Plate and Enjoy:
- Divide the egg and rice mixture between four plates.
- Serve immediately for a satisfying and simple dinner.
